The Development of Space Travel: From Vision to Reality

In the early years of space science, those who traveled in space started doing something weird. Common people visiting space began to take hold in the 1960s when Pan Am Airways famously offered tickets for forthcoming space missions. But the ideal did not come true until 2001 when American businessman Dennis Tito paid for a visit to the International Space Station, therefore becoming the first space tourist. This historic event attracted attention and prepared commercial businesses to intervene and provide access to space flight for common explorers.

Already allowing customers consider space flight as a sensible option are companies like SpaceX, Blue Origin, and Virgin Galactic. Elon Musk started SpaceX and gained attention with his development of reusable rocket technologies. First all-civilian crew on the Inspiration4 project launched by their Dragon spacecraft exactly returned in 2021. Apart from proving that non-professional astronauts could safely reach space, this historic event attracted great attention concerning space tourism and produced money for charity.

Meanwhile Jeff Bezos’s Blue Origin is focused on suborbital flights. Few minutes of weightlessness and amazing views of Earth have come from many test flights with individuals seeing their New Shepard rocket safely soar. Leading Virgin Galactic, Richard Branson also participates in the mix providing suborbital spaceflights. Effective test flights with civilian passengers have shown that the goal of space travel is more near than it has ever been.

Key Players and Innovations in Space Tourism

The space tourism industry is becoming hot thanks to a few innovative companies realizing dreams of star travel are a feasible possibility. With their ambitious Starship, SpaceX hopes to be able to carry a large cargo and explore interplanets. While test missions are still under development, every successful launch moves us closer the day when normal people may book a trip to space or maybe Mars. On the other hand, the New Shepard of Blue Origin is entirely focused on that suborbital experience. Having completed many uncrewed missions already, this rocket is on target to carry humans on an amazing journey just beyond the edge of space. With its Space Ship Two, launched by a mothership before igniting its engines, Virgin Galactic is doing something somewhat differently at last. Their primary intention is to allow space travel to everybody; they have already completed several successful crewed test flights.

Leading the push in technological innovation are also these companies, including reusable rockets, which not only save money but also make space travel more ecologically benign. Reusability will help to make space tourism an annual event. Moreover, the concept of space habitats is becoming more and more relevant as humans may live and work in space more practically.
